New energy vehicles mainly consist of battery drive systems, motor systems, electronic control systems, and assembly components. The motor, electronic control, and assembly are basically the same as traditional cars, but the reason for the price difference is the battery drive system. From the perspective of the cost composition of new energy vehicles, battery drive systems account for 30-45% of the cost of new energy vehicles, while power lithium batteries account for approximately 75-85% of the cost composition of battery drive systems.
The core to solving the high price of new energy vehicles is to reduce the one-time procurement cost of power lithium batteries. The commercialized power lithium batteries in the market mainly include Lithium iron phosphate battery, lithium manganate battery and ternary material battery. The Chinese market is dominated by Lithium iron phosphate, and Japan and South Korea mostly choose the hybrid battery system of lithium manganate and ternary material. CCID's statistics show that the price of domestic Lithium iron phosphate battery is about 3-4 yuan/Wh, and that of lithium manganate and ternary material batteries is about 4-5 yuan/Wh. Considering the battery capacity of different types of new energy vehicles, the battery capacity of plug-in hybrid vehicles is 10-16KWh, the battery capacity of pure electric vehicles is 24-60KWh, and the battery capacity of pure electric buses is generally 200-400Kwh, corresponding to battery prices ranging from 30000 to 50000 yuan, 70000 to 180000 yuan, and 600000 to 1.2 million yuan. Such high battery prices are the main reason for the high prices of new energy vehicles.
